Investment Focus and Strategy
Maven Income and Growth VCT 5 maintains its strategy of targeting smaller enterprises and companies listed on growth-focused markets. These investments are carefully selected to qualify under venture capital trust rules, allowing the fund to pursue growth capital opportunities.
The emphasis remains on sectors with long-term potential, where early-stage funding can generate substantial future returns. However, these investments also involve elevated risks, which may translate into shorter-term volatility in trading performance.
